<strong><u><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black">William and Lynda Steere Herbarium</span></u></strong><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black"><o:p></o:p></span></p>
<p style="mso-margin-top-alt: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:.25in;margin-left:0in;line-height:18.0pt;background:white">
<span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black">The William and Lynda Steere Herbarium is the foundation of NYBG’s scientific research programs. Holding 7.8 million specimens, the Herbarium is the third largest collection of its
 kind in the world. The collection is global in scope, with particular strengths in the Americas and Caribbean. It represents every major plant, algal, and fungal group, and has been well-curated throughout our 130-year history. The Herbarium serves as a leader
 in the global natural history collections community—providing data, sharing essential stewardship protocols with other institutions, and continually developing and streamlining digitization techniques. The Herbarium is staffed with 17+ members devoted to managing
 and maintaining the physical and digital collections. This is an extremely active herbarium, every year adding 40,000 specimens, providing 28,000 specimens on loan to researchers physically and digitally, and hosting 2,000 days of visiting scientists. Specimen
 digitization began in 1995. To date, 4.2 million specimens have been digitized, ±500,000 within the last two years. All digital collections and resources are freely available through the C.V. Starr Virtual Herbarium. The Herbarium is also competitive in grant
 funding, receiving 17 grants from NSF over the last ten years, in addition to grants from private funders such as Google and the Andrew W. Mellon Foundation.<o:p></o:p></span></p>

<strong><u><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black">NYBG Science</span></u></strong><span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black"><o:p></o:p></span></p>
<p style="mso-margin-top-alt: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:.25in;margin-left:0in;line-height:18.0pt;background:white">
<span style="font-size:9.0pt;font-family:"Helvetica",sans-serif;color:black">NYBG is a world leader in the research and conservation of plants, algae, and fungi, using both traditional and cutting-edge tools to discover, understand, and conserve Earth’s vast
 botanical diversity. NYBG's Science Division comprises the Steere Herbarium, the Mertz Library, and the Pfizer Laboratory, along with an active group of botanical scientists. Currently, 17 curators, 3 postdocs, and 22 graduate students conduct research in
 NYBG’s Science Division. Curators mentor Ph.D. and M.S. students from various institutions as well as undergraduate students and high school interns. Staff and affiliated scholars comprise a robust community of scientists who drive a diverse array of research
 programs. Active research topics include floristics, taxonomy, molecular systematics, genomics, bioinformatics, conservation, ethnobotany, and the effects of climate change. Our field research is based in many parts of the globe, e.g., the Neotropics, Southeast
 Asia, the Pacific, and throughout North America.<o:p></o:p></span></p>
